What is it about fractals that invokes a sense of insanity?
Is it the repetition of fractals and the patterns that perfectly repeat within themselves like a self reflective inward looking mirror? Much like the insane mind, endless repetitions of hyper critical self doubt that go on forever with a familiar spirit-crushing predictability.
Could it be that fractals are built of mathematical formula and often depict the same patterns you see at different points throughout the universe?
From the spiral of your fingerprint to the shape of the galaxy in which you reside. From the turbulence in clouds to the currents in the deepest oceans. From the Lichtenberg patterns of erosion found in mountain ranges, to the dendrites of tree branches, lightning branches or the patterns of the inside of your lungs. Fractals are everywhere, building the shape of the universe, even in Azathoth's dreams the same sacred patterns exist.
